Use a spar varnish on the cabinets. It is what is used on wooden boats.
Take one of the doors to the paint department of your home improvement store and ask for their advice. They may have products and ideas you never considered.
The best you can do IS use spar varnish like 2dogal suggests. Won't be 100% waterproof. I use Helmsman Spar Urethane also used on boats.
That would be difficult if they aren't totally built for exterior but are in the elements. Even if you put on a coat of marine grade paint/varnish on the surface, you still could have water wicking up from the bottom, as well as have the glue and staples degrading from moisture.
